Trendelenburg Positioning Attribute
The Trendelenburg placing feature in a medical facility bed can significantly impact your treatment experience. This ability allows the bed to turn your body downward, with your head lower than your feet. It's particularly valuable for improving blood circulation and assisting in specific medical conditions. If you're recuperating from surgery or handling conditions like shock, this setting can help boost blood flow to crucial body organs. In addition, it can aid in breathing therapy by advertising lung development. Water Resistant Treatment Choices
Selecting the right waterproof covering for your medical facility bed mattress is crucial for maintaining health and comfort. You'll locate several choices available, each offering unique benefits. Vinyl treatments are very easy and long lasting to tidy, making them a functional option for securing versus mishaps and spills. They may really feel much less comfy contrasted to various other materials.On the various other hand, moisture-wicking textiles offer breathability and gentleness, boosting your total comfort while still supplying waterproof protection. Look for covers that are both water resistant and breathable to avoid heat build-up. Furthermore, think about the mattress kind; some covers are particularly designed for memory foam or gel cushions. Safety Functions: Side Rails and Brakes
When selecting a hospital bed, safety and security attributes like side rails and brakes play a vital role in assuring client security and stability. Side rails aid avoid drops, especially for individuals who may be dizzy or have restricted movement. Seek beds with adjustable side rails, as they can be reduced for very easy access while still supplying assistance when needed.Brakes are equally crucial, allowing you to protect the bed in area. A bed that rolls can pose dangers, specifically throughout transfers or when a client is getting in or out. Validate the brakes are easy to engage and disengage, ideally with a foot pedal or hand control, so you can promptly lock the bed when necessary.Choosing a bed with these security functions can greatly enhance individual treatment and offer you assurance, knowing that security is a leading priority in your care atmosphere.
